Subject: Annual billing — heads up before the rollout

Team,

As flagged at the Harvell offsite, we're moving Quillbase customers to annual billing starting next cycle. Monthly stays available but with a modest premium, so expect questions at the branches. Renata's crew has talking points ready, and we'll run a webinar for branch managers next week. Early pilots in the Ostmere region went smoothly — churn barely moved. Please keep messaging consistent and route edge cases to central. One more thing for your eyes only.

management briefing: The pricing group signed off on a budget of $378.8 million for Project Kasael.

## Releases

Orders are never hard-deleted. The `orders.deleted_at` column drives soft deletes; the nightly Quillback job archives rows older than 18 months. Before cutting a release, confirm the archive job ran clean — a stuck job blocks migration 0142. Release artifacts are built by the Pellwood pipeline, tagged, and signed. Do not ship unsigned builds to the Marrowgate environment under any circumstances. Verify the signature against the key below before promotion. The current release signing key is as follows.

signing key of bagap-yawep = bky13_TbfT6ZMUoGJo2

TICKET-4471: Bump Fennelwick schema registry to v9

Compatibility mode changes from BACKWARD to FULL_TRANSITIVE. Breaks two legacy producers on the Ordway events bus; owners notified. Migration script staged, rollback tested. Do not deploy during ingest peak (02:00–05:00). On-call: if registry rejects writes post-deploy, revert config and page platform. Needs sign-off before merge. Approver of record is listed below.

named custodian: Brivan Eliath Quenox Frador